2014 Marvel Comics Event Centers on Death of Uatu the Watcher - Original Sin

Jason Aaron and Mike Deodato Jr. will be up next to bat for the Marvel Comics event book for 2014 entitled "Original Sin"


CBR reports that this is going to be thematically different from past events mainly because its a murder mystery. The original Nick Fury will show up once again (last seen in Age of Ultron) and acts as detective. The report goes on with naming the main characters for the story who will be joining Fury in solving the murder:


Captain America, Iron Man, Thor, The Punisher, Emma Frost, Ant Man, Doctor Strange, and Black Panther. (the last three kinda reminds me of the Marvel Cinematic Universe's assumed phase 4 movies)

In the span of four months, we'll be seeing how this occured and the massive fallout. Remember, The Watcher keeps track of everything everybody in the 616 does, which will lead in to ORIGINAL SIN # 0 by Mark Waid and Jim Cheung.

WOLVERINE AND THE X-MEN # 35 Spoilers - Nightcrawler Teaser

Jason Aaron's latest arc in WOLVERINE AND THE X-MEN entitled "The Hellfire Saga" has ended and it brings some interesting twists and status quo changes.


Some of the things that happened in the final chapter of WAXM's "Hellfire Saga" arc.

Idie and Quintin Quire are finally a couple:

You may or may not like the pairing (I'm for the for the former) but you can't help but think that this was already revealed in an early issue of WATXM. It's only now that things have started to move towards that direction. Which could also mean that Evan/ Genesis becomes Apocalypse is getting closer.

BROO returns

Thanks to a familiar yet mysterious figure, we get Broo back. If you're unsure what happened to the little feller, he was shot in a makeshift Church by Max Frankenstein point blank. The X-Men stitched him back up but at the cost of Broo's intellect. An encounter with a blue Bamf however has made it certain that the returning Nightcrawler gets a good tease.
